Many of the memory items, (perhaps all ?), will ONLY remember the position if you are in the PARK position of your transmission. I was having that same sort of issue, until I finally read the manual.
I know it is stupid, it doesn't work like any of my other cars that have the memory options. For those others I just activate the "remember this" button sequence, which might be holding the Drive# button for more than a couple of seconds to then hear a "beep" (like the H2 does) or first pressing a Memory button and then the desired Driver# (like my BMW and my Jeep GC).
It is only the Hummer that requires me to be in the PARK position. Weird, but once you learn that...
